/**
* \file getcwd.cpp
* This file is part of LyX, the document processor.
* Licence details can be found in the file COPYING.
*
* \author Lars Gullik Bjønnes
*
* Full author contact details are available in file CREDITS.
*/
#include <config.h>
#include "support/lyxlib.h"
#include "support/os.h"
#include <boost/scoped_array.hpp>
#include <cerrno>
#ifdef HAVE_UNISTD_H
# include <unistd.h>
#endif
#ifdef _WIN32
# include <windows.h>
#endif
using boost::scoped_array;
using std::string;
namespace lyx {
namespace support {
namespace {
inline
char * l_getcwd(char * buffer, size_t size)
{
#ifdef _WIN32
GetCurrentDirectory(size, buffer);
return buffer;
#else
return ::getcwd(buffer, size);
#endif
}
} // namespace anon
// Returns current working directory
FileName const getcwd()
{
int n = 256; // Assume path is less than 256 chars
char * err;
scoped_array<char> tbuf(new char[n]);
// Safe. Hopefully all getcwds behave this way!
while (((err = l_getcwd(tbuf.get(), n)) == 0) && (errno == ERANGE)) {
// Buffer too small, double the buffersize and try again
n *= 2;
tbuf.reset(new char[n]);
}
string result;
if (err)
result = tbuf.get();
return FileName(os::internal_path(to_utf8(from_filesystem8bit(result))));
}
} // namespace support
} // namespace lyx
